Default Odd shift points???

My truck is completely bone stock. The previous owner put a stock (ugh) replacement trans in it about 20k ago. It shifts firm, and doesn't feel like it's slipping any, but when you reach about 40mph, you have to back out of the throttle almost all the way before it will shift to the next gear. Once it finally shifts, the shift feels firm and normal. Any ideas??? Thanks!

mine had done that when the tps wasnt reading right. check the tps plug and make sure there isnt corrosion or contaminants in it hope it helps

Originally Posted by TreeSurgeon
what is the tps and where is it? Mine is doing the exact same thing.
Throttle Position Sensor. It's a little black electrical box a couple of inches square at the very front of your throttle linkage. Only took me a couple of min to remove and change.
